Counterfeit Cash Reports Double In Boston

In another sign of troubled financial times, Boston Police say reports of counterfeit cash nearly doubled last year from 2007.

Last month, a Dorchester man was arrested and charged with passing at least $100,000 in fake bills.

The Boston Herald reports the majority of the city's more than 100 victims were taxi drivers and food service workers.

The counterfeit bills mostly changed hands in Roxbury, Mattapan and Dorchester.
